Determining Fault in a Long Island Hit and Run Accident
When you suffer injuries in a hit and run accident, determining fault can be tricky. The police could locate a hit and run driver after an injury accident. However, even if they arrest the person who left the scene, you must still prove that they caused your injuries.
Common Causes of Hit and Run Incidents in Long Island
Part of determining fault after a hit and run is establishing the accident’s cause. In Long Island, some of the most common causes of these accidents are:
- Speeding
- Illegal passing
- Failing to yield the right-of-way
- Failure to obey traffic signals and signs
- Inattentive or distracted driving
- Driving while intoxicated
A person may also decide to flee the accident scene for a variety of reasons. They may not have a license or insurance, or they might fear an arrest for driving while intoxicated (DWI). Regardless of the reason, the at-fault driver should be held accountable for the injuries they caused.
When You Cannot Locate the Hit and Run Driver After Your Accident
If the police or your lawyer do not find the driver responsible for your injuries, you could still seek compensation. During the investigation, you can begin a claim with your personal injury protection (PIP) insurance. PIP coverage applies regardless of fault, and you can often file a PIP claim if you were walking or biking when the incident occurred.
You may also be able to seek compensation through your uninsured motorist coverage after a hit and run. Uninsured motorist coverage may apply if the hit and run driver does not have insurance coverage to meet your total losses.
If you do not have PIP or uninsured motorist coverage, you may seek medical attention through your health insurance carrier. A hit and run attorney on Long Island knows which insurance coverage applies. They can walk you through the process and help you file your claim.

Follow Hit and Run Criminal Proceedings
We may also get evidence from criminal legal proceedings, if possible. When someone is injured, it is illegal for the other driver to leave the scene of the accident without reporting to the police, per VAT § 600. If officers can locate the perpetrator, they may file criminal charges for the hit and run incident.
A criminal case is separate from your personal injury case. Your attorney could use evidence from the criminal case to establish fault and support your damage claims.

Meet Legal Deadlines
CPLR § 214 establishes a three-year statute of limitations for filing a personal injury claim. While you typically have three years from the accident to file a lawsuit, the time limit may differ depending on your circumstances. Your attorney could request an extension, so do not let the time limit prevent you from reaching out to a lawyer about your accident.Â
